Download Theo and Get Involved This Ichthyosis Awareness Month

During Ichthyosis Awareness Month, you can help raise understanding and support by bringing Theo, the Ichthyosis Support Group mascot, to life. Simply download and print Theo, and let your creativity shine. He’s not looking his usual colourful self yet — and that’s because he needs you to colour him in.

Theo is a fun and engaging way to start conversations about ichthyosis at school, at home, or in your community. By colouring, displaying, and sharing Theo, you can help others learn about ichthyosis and show their support for people living with the condition.

Ideas to get involved

  • Hold a colouring competition in your class, school, or group, with prizes for creativity.
  • Display your finished Theos on classroom walls, noticeboards, or windows to spark curiosity and awareness.
  • Start conversations about ichthyosis during assemblies or awareness activities.
  • Take Theo on an adventure — photograph him in different places and share his journey.
  • Share your creations with friends, family, and your wider community to spread the word.

Every coloured Theo helps raise awareness, encourages understanding, and shows support for the ichthyosis community. Whether one person takes part or a whole school joins in, your involvement makes a real difference.
